META_CALL_PROGRESS, META_CALL_REMOVING_PARTY, META_CALL_STARTING, META_CALL_TRANSFERRING, META_SNAPSHOT, META_UNKNOWN Methods Table 61: Methods in CiscoAddrRecordingConfigChangedEv Description Method Interface Returns the new recording configuration on this Address. The value is one of the following: • CiscoAddress.NO_RECORDING • CiscoAddress.AUTO_RECORDING • CiscoAddress.APPLICATION_CONTROLLED_RECORDING getRecordingConfig() Int Returns the Terminal on which the recording configuration changed. getTerminal() javax.telephony.Terminal Inherited Methods From Interface javax.telephony.events.Ev getCause, getID, getMetaCode, getObserved, isNewMetaEvent From Interface javax.telephony.events.AddrEv getAddress From Interface javax.telephony.events.Ev getCause, getID, getMetaCode, getObserved, isNewMetaEvent Related Documentation See Constant Field Values, on page 1667 and CiscoAddrEv for more information. CiscoAddrRemovedEv JTAPI sends the CiscoAddrRemovedEv event when an Address gets removed from the Provider domain.
